What force acts upward and opposes weight?

Lift

2
New cards

What two things generate lift?

Relative wind and wing design (airfoil)

3
New cards

What is weight in aviation?

The combined downward force of the aircraft its contents and occupants

4
New cards

Through what point does weight act?

Center of gravity (CG)

5
New cards

What force propels the aircraft forward?

Thrust

6
New cards

What must thrust overcome for the airplane to move forward?

Drag

7
New cards

What is drag?

Rearward force that opposes forward motion

8
New cards

What are the two main types of drag?

Parasite drag and induced drag

9
New cards

What causes parasite drag?

Aircraft shape and surface

10
New cards

Name the three types of parasite drag.

Form drag interference drag skin friction drag

11
New cards

What is form drag?

Drag caused by air flowing around an aircraft's shape

12
New cards

What is interference drag?

Drag from airflow streams meeting and causing turbulence

13
New cards

What is skin friction drag?

Microscopic friction of air against the aircraft surface

14
New cards

What causes induced drag?

It is created as a byproduct of lift

15
New cards

What happens to parasite drag as airspeed increases?

It increases exponentially

16
New cards

What happens to induced drag as airspeed increases?

It decreases

17
New cards

In steady unaccelerated flight what is the relationship between lift and weight?

Lift equals weight

18
New cards

At what airspeed is total drag at its minimum?

LD Max (best lift to drag ratio)
